Topsolar Flexible Solar Panel 100W 24V/12V Monocrystalline Bendable - 100 Watt 12Volt Semi-Flexible Mono Solar Panels Charger Off-Grid for RV Boat Cabin Van Car Uneven Surfaces Black







Key features
- •Perfect for 12 volt battery charging, multiple panels can be wired in series for 24 48 volt batteries charging. It is better to use with a controller to protect the battery, The attached cable compatible with Connector, the solar panel can be connect to the solar controller/regulator easily.
- •Good bendability: The solar panel can be curved to a maximum 30 degree arc, allowing to be mounted on an RV, boat, cabin, tent, car, trucks, trailers, yacht, motorhome, Roofs, or any other irregular surface.
- •High conversion efficiency: High efficient monocrystalline solar cell, adopt unique back contact technology and remove electrodes on the solar cell surface that block the sunshine to increase the solar panel conversion efficiency up to 50% more efficiency than ordinary.
- •Durability and high waterproof grade: High temperature resistance,easier to clean. The solar panel made of advanced water resistant material. It is far more durable than traditional glass and aluminum models.
- •Lightweight and easy installation: Only 0.1 inch thick and weighs only 3.72 LBS, this solar panel is easy to transport, hang, and remove, 6 stainless eyelets at the edges for easy installation. Fast and inexpensive mounting, easy to transport and mount. It can be affixed by adhesives, silicon glues, double sticky tapes, zip ties or Velcro, perfect for non-permanent installations.

Works good so far.
blade✓ Verified Purchase•September 12, 2023
I don't know about tech support I haven't used it. It's charging LiPo battery up with out a problem today. I have not mounted it yet so it's being used as a portable panel until I get it mounted and a second one. Maybe third one, I'm planning on having two or three mounted on my vehicle roof to charge a "LiPo house battery". I'm thinking about getting a few more for my RV roof too, I might be able to mount 3 on it too. But I will need another controller and to relocate and change battery type in RV. I will try to update after more use.
As of 8 April 22 the panel is still working very well for me, I upgraded the solar charger and
mounted on roof rack of my Jeep. I'm thinking about ordering two more still. I've upgraded my storage battery and the company recommends 300 watts of solar power to charge it. So I do need them.
Update 4 June 22: I've removed it from the original mounted location to use as a portable panel (I've framed it in light weight aluminum) that makes it easy to move around to track the sun. In my use with air gap from surface it's regularly out performing the 100w rating in less than ideal sunlight even. I highly recommend this panel and would have bought 2 or more. If I didn't find a pair of rigid 100w panels to try at lower cost (after adding my cost for aluminum to frame for mounting). Light weight, still has good output when part of panel is blocked from full sunlight and at less than ideal angle to sunlight, plus is hasn't been damaged by cats wanting to walk or lay on it.
Now if I could get as lucky buying a lottery tickets as I've been with this panel.
Update on the solar panel: I had used it for short time as a portable panel and found the ridge panel that I replaced it with higher capacity didn't perform as well. So I ordered a second one and now have both mounted. I highly recommend them, especially if you are going to mount them where they will not always be in ideal condition for best performance.
27 Apr. 2023: update on the 2 100w panels both are working fine still, I'm ordering a few more. I have nothing bad to say about them, I'm adding 3 pictures to my review, the 3rd is showing the current charging from the2 panels. It's a overcast rainy "day 2" of it, the battery is running a fridge freezer that I bought on Amazon a couple years ago. If I have 5 plus days of overcast/ cloudy weather (fall or winter "less daylight" ) the 100 amp LiPo battery can get discharged to point of shut down. The system I've got setup charges the "house" battery with the 2 100w panels first then adds to vehicle batteries secondary. On that subject my vehicle hasn't been started in over 4-5 days, but it has it's own solar system on it too. A stand alone 85w system.

Excellent Solar Panel for Bluetti EB3A Charging in Tucson!
Kristian Skarsfeldt✓ Verified Purchase•September 4, 2023
I recently purchased the Topsolar Flexible Solar Panel 100W 24V/12V Monocrystalline Bendable to complement my new Bluetti EB3A power station, and I must say I am impressed with its performance so far. Being here in Tucson, I needed a reliable and efficient solar panel, and this one has delivered on its promises.
The panel's charging capabilities have been exceptional, allowing my Bluetti EB3A to recharge efficiently even during sunny afternoons. I took a picture on July 30th, 2023, at 2 pm, and the panel was producing a consistent 53W, which seems to be normal for a 100W panel under real-world conditions.
One of the key highlights of this flexible solar panel is its bendable design, which makes it easy to set up in different locations and angles. However, I did notice a slight concern when flexing the panel; some of the strings inside made popping sounds. While this hasn't affected its functionality so far, I'm uncertain if it's a sign of potential issues in the long run. I hope Topsolar can address this in future iterations.
Overall, I'm pleased with my purchase. The Topsolar 100W Flexible Solar Panel has been reliable and efficient in charging my Bluetti EB3A, which is crucial for my off-grid power needs. If you're looking for a durable and high-performing solar panel for your portable power station, I recommend considering this one. However, I would advise checking with the manufacturer regarding the popping sounds during flexing to ensure its longevity.
Pros:
Efficient charging in sunny conditions.
Bendable design for easy setup.
Compatible with Bluetti EB3A and other power stations.
Cons:
Popping sounds when flexing; potential long-term concerns.
Overall, a great purchase for my solar needs in Tucson!
